Subversion Repositories HelenOS-historic

Rev

Go to most recent revision | Blame | Last modification | View Log | Download | RSS feed

  1. #ifndef __mips_REGNAME_H_
  2. #define __mips_REGNAME_H_
  3.  
  4. #define zero    0
  5. #define at      1
  6. #define v0      2
  7. #define v1      3
  8. #define a0      4
  9. #define a1      5
  10. #define a2      6
  11. #define a3      7
  12. #define t0      8
  13. #define t1      9
  14. #define t2      10
  15. #define t3      11
  16. #define t4      12
  17. #define t5      13
  18. #define t6      14
  19. #define t7      15
  20. #define s0      16
  21. #define s1      17
  22. #define s2      18
  23. #define s3      19
  24. #define s4      20
  25. #define s5      21
  26. #define s6      22
  27. #define s7      23
  28. #define t8      24
  29. #define t9      25
  30. #define k0      26
  31. #define k1      27
  32. #define gp      28
  33. #define sp      29
  34. #define s8      30
  35. #define ra      31
  36.  
  37. #define index       0
  38. #define random      1
  39. #define entrylo0    2
  40. #define entrylo1    3
  41. #define context     4
  42. #define pagemask    5
  43. #define wired       6
  44. #define badvaddr    8
  45. #define count       9
  46. #define entryhi     10
  47. #define compare     11
  48. #define status      12
  49. #define cause       13
  50. #define epc     14
  51. #define config      16
  52. #define lladdr      17
  53. #define watchlo     18
  54. #define watchhi     19
  55. #define xcontext    20
  56. #define debug       23
  57. #define depc        24
  58. #define eepc        30
  59.  
  60.  
  61. #endif /* _REGNAME_H_ */
  62.